[Adjustment Procedure]
1. Using the R/C, set the LCD TV to adjustment mode.
2.
Measure max. brightness L
max
.
3. Calculate min. brightness L
min
= L
max
/ 5000.
4. Measure Point 2 brightness (L
high
)
5. Set the reference value R,G,B of Point 2 (R2) = 3664 x (229 / P2)
where P2 = 255 x [(L
high
– L
min
) / (L
max
– L
min
)]
1/2.2
6. Set the specified gradation for point 2, fix the most faint colour to get
reference value, adjust others 2 colour to minus adjustment for
reference value of point 2.
7. Measure Point 1 brightness (L
low
).
8. Set the reference value R,G,B of Point 1 (R1) = 640 x (40 / P1)
where P1 = 255 x [(L
low
– L
min
) / (L
max
– L
min
)]
1/2.2
9.Set the specified gradation for point 1. Set G of point 1 to the default
value [(R1 x G value of point 2 / R2), with fractions rounded] and adjust
RB to the reference value of point 1
10. Adjusted value is writing at [command] MSET0003.
11. Set the G of point Max. to the default value (4080 x G value of point 2 /
R2). Set the R,B Max. value [G
max
– G value of point 2 + (R,B value of
point 2)]
